Crowley law enforcement supports Faith House

The Crowley Sheriff’s Department received Hershey’s candy Hugs and Kisses during Faith House “Kiss a Cop, Hug a Judge” campaign held in early October. Accepting thank you cards and candy from the children of Faith House were Deputy Gilford Richard, Detective Chad Gibson, Trisha Breaux of Faith House and Sheriff Wayne Melancon.
